State Police at Schuylkill Haven - crashes

State police at the Schuylkill Haven barracks reported the following crashes:

• Lauren A. Sophy, 21, of Slatington, was cited for driving on roadways laned for traffic after a two-vehicle crash at 4:53 a.m. June 10 in Pine Creek Drive in West Brunswick Township. No one was injured in the incident.

Police said she was driving a 2014 Chevrolet Silverado that was involved in the mishap with a 2019 Toyota Tacoma driven by Kade J. Spitler, 27, of Orwigsburg.

• William J. Fessler, 26, of Pottsville, sustained suspected minor injuries in a one-vehicle crash at 8:51 p.m. June 1 on Route 61 in North Manheim Township.

Police said he was transported by personnel from the Orwigsburg Police Department to the Geisinger-St. Luke’s Hospital, Orwigsburg.

Police said he was driving a 2015 Harley Davidson that struck a pothole, causing him to lose control of the cycle, which traveled to the right side of the road and struck a curb, overturning and sliding about 100 yards down the roadway.

The cycle had to be towed from the scene.

Police said Fessler was cited for “classes of licenses.”
